    math webinarBringing the Math Wars to an End (Register)

    Just like “The Reading Wars” fought between phonics and whole language, there are equivalent Math Wars between approaches that are more focused on procedural understanding and others focused more on conceptual understanding. But, unlike the Reading Wars which have ended, skirmishes in the Math Wars are ongoing. This webinar is designed to thoughtfully explore this challenge and offer critical perspective on how to bring the Math Wars to an end. Click Here to register.

    Foundations in Leadership and Vision Foundational Course

    IASA is pleased to announce the release of a new dynamic learning opportunity, "Pathway to the Superintendency: Foundations in Leadership and Vision." This hybrid course will introduce participants to the core competencies and mindsets essential for aspiring superintendents, focusing on the School Leader Paradigm framework to develop skills in vision-building, equity-centered decision-making, and personal resilience.
